    Influence of Local Melting on the Strength of 316L/7075 Dissimilar Metal Bonding Interface in Ultrasonic Spot Welding |

    | Abstract Scope | 
    
This study elucidated the formation of approximately 1-μm precipitate layers of Al18Mg3Cr2 and Al6(Cu, Fe) during the ultrasonic welding of 316L steel and 7075 aluminum alloy. These precipitate layers formed at interfacial temperatures exceeding 470°C, occurring at approximately 1-2 um away from the steel/Al interface. The continuous formation of these layers was attributed to localized melting, which  led to strength saturation of the weld at 2.75 kN. |
